The militant Kilusang Magbubukid ng Pilipinas (KMP) castigated Tarlac Rep. Benigno “Noynoy” Aquino III for misrepresenting the Catholic Bishops Conference of the Philippines (CBCP) and saying that they will no longer help in the settlement of the Luisita dispute because of the so-called intrasingence of its labor leaders. According to Danilo “Ka Daning” Ramos, secreatry general of KMP, “Noynoy’s statement is pure hogwash. I just called Bishop Fernando Capalla, president of CBCP, and he said they never said that,also Noynoy is not present in their meetings and has no authority to issue statements regarding their positions on issues,” “That is mere propaganda on the part of the Cojuangco-Aquino clans to prevent the people from seeing the real score and that up till now the management is dealing with the farm workers in bad faith, and even resorted to have Tarlac Councilor Abel Ladera killed to silence him. Now another Luisita supporter named Danny Macapagal of BAYAN-Nueva Ecija was abducted early this morning at his house by unidentified armed men. This is the continuation of the reign of terror of the Northern Luzon Command as well as the Cojuangco-Aquino clans,” added the peasant leader. As for his part Carl Anthony Ala,public information officer of KMP, “it is in this light that the military also wants to silence the media in interviewing so-called terrorist organizations, that they themselves will brand. When you complain or air your grievances against the military and the government you and/or your organization will be branded as terrorist. This is not only the curtailment of the freedom of speech and of expression, this is patently a fascist maneuver of the AFP and Malacanang,” “What they want is media on a leash and will only say what the military or Malacanang wants to hear. The anti-terror bill has not even been enacted yet but the human rights situation in our country is in such a dire strait that we now next to Iraq as the most dangerous place for journalists,” added Ala. “If this law is passed media would not
only have a leash on its neck it would also have a cocked gun pointed at
its temple,” ended Ala. # # #
